Conference

We invite you to young researchers: students, undergraduates, doctoral students and academic staff of your organization to participate in the Republican Scientific and Practical Conference of Young Scientists  «SCIENCE. EDUCATION. YOUTH» will be held  on April 21-22, 2022  in Almaty.

 

Conference organizer: Almaty Technological University.
Languages of the Conference: Kazakh, Russian and English.

 

Thematic areas (sections) of the Conference:

- Technology of Food and Processing Industry;
- Light and Textile Industry;
- Mechanization, Automation andComputerization of Technological Processes;
- General-economic problems, Hospitality Industry;
- Natural Sciences;
- Social and Humanitarian Sciences.

 

Reports presentation:

Reports and Intelligence, not more than 3 full text pages (including graphic materials) are represented in interactive form (sent in electron form to the following e-mail: http://register.atu.kz/rnpk/  or could be brought on electron data carrier to the organizing committee). Name of the file –the surname of the first author. Typesetting -  Times New Roman, Times New Roman KK EK, format: MS Word 95/97/2000/XP, bookish, print size – 14, line-to-line spacing –single, all sides backgrounds – 20 mm.

Text of the report must be completed in the following order: at the beginning of the document in the left upper corner UDC index is shown, then on the next line right in the middle the name of the report (with capital letters), on the next page – surname and initials of the authors also academic degree, place of work, city, country and e-mail  must be shown. From the next line the text of report must be represented. Text is original and cannot be edited.  At the end of the report references must be shown. References are required.

The number of articles from one author is no more than 2. In one article no more than 3 co-authors.

The deadline for reports – 03  April, 2022. The organizing committee  reserves the right to decline reports completed with breach of requirements, reports, mismatching to the subject areas or which were received after 03  April, 2022.

After obtaining the notification of acceptance of the report to the publication from the Organizing committee, authors need to submit the scanned copy of the payment document (organizing fee) to the following address: conference@atu.kz.  Deadline for submission of documents for payment of organizing fee - up to 18 April,  2022.

Reports will be published in Proceedings of the Conference during a month after the end of the Conference  and will be placed on the site www.atu.kz.

International Scientific and Practical Conference “Innovative development of food, light industry and hospitality industry”. The Almaty Scientific and Technological University on October 25-26, 2018 held the International Scientific and Practical Conference “Innovative development of food, light industry and hospitality industry.”

 

The conference was attended by scientists, specialists, government and public figures, representatives of relevant business structures of the Republic of Kazakhstan, the CIS and abroad.

 

Before the opening of the conference, the guests familiarized themselves with the exhibition of scientific achievements of scientists of Almaty Technological University. The conference was opened by the First Vice-Rector of the ATU, Professor Nurakhmetov Baurzhan Kumargaliyevich.

 

At the plenary meeting of the conference the following reports were made:

  • Natalia Mokeeva – Doctor of Technical Sciences, Professor, Head of the Department “Technology and Design of Apparel Products”, with a report on the topic: “The system of evaluation tools in the preparation of masters”;
  • Lyudmila Vasilyevna Antipova – Doctor of Technical Sciences, Professor of the Department of Technology of Animal Products of the Voronezh State University of Engineering Technologies, with a report on the topic: “Intercollegiate and interdisciplinary interactions are the basis for solving modern problems in science and education”;
  • Azret Utebaevich Shingisov – Doctor of Technical Sciences, Professor, Head of the Technology and Safety of Food Products Department of the South Kazakhstan State University named after M. Auezov, with a report on the topic: “Scientific substantiation of the storage modes of fruit and vegetable products”;
  • Kolesnikova Svetlana Vasilyevna – Head of GR-projects of the branch of EFKO Management Company JSC, with a report on the topic: “Global trends in the development of the oil and fat industry”.

 

Further work of the conference was organized in 4 thematic sections. The informative programmatic reports presented at the sectional sessions highlighted the results of many years of research by domestic and foreign scientists on the current state, trends and prospects for the development of the food and hospitality industry, analyzed aspects of improving technology, economic, managerial and social aspects of the development and training of industry specialists.

 

During the discussions, possible solutions to the most significant problems and promising areas for further research were formulated. 258 reports were submitted for publication in the conference collection, which was published before the conference began.

 

Following the conference, it was decided to continue the experience of international scientific cooperation on the development of food, light industry and the hospitality industry, economic issues, as well as training specialists for these industries.

International Scientific and Practical Conference Innovative development of food, light industry and hospitality industry “dedicated to the 60th anniversary of the Almaty Technological University on October 6 and 7, 2017, the International Scientific and Practical Conference Innovative development of food, light industry and the hospitality industry, dedicated to the 60th anniversary of the Almaty Technological University, was held at the Almaty Technological University.

 

The conference was attended by scientists, specialists, government and public figures, representatives of relevant business structures of the Republic of Kazakhstan, the CIS and abroad.

 

The conference was opened by the Rector of the ATU, Academician Kulazhanov Talgat Kuralbekovich. At the plenary meeting of the conference the following reports were made:

  • Michael Muller Trade Advisor to the Austrian Embassy in the Republic of Kazakhstan.
  • Kolyo Tenev, Director of the University of Food Technologies in the City of Plovdiv (Bulgaria), with a presentation on the topic: Use of baromembrane methods to improve technological processes in the dairy industry
  • Shtykhno Dmitry Aleksandrovich Vice-Rector for Development of the Russian Economic University. G.V.Plekhanova (Russia) with a report on the theme “Hospitality industry as a driver of innovation.

 

Further work of the conference was organized in 3 thematic sections. The reports presented at the breakout sessions highlighted the results of many years of research by domestic and foreign scientists on the current state, trends and prospects for the development of food, light industry and hospitality industry, as well as analyzed the issues of technical re-equipment of enterprises, considered economic, managerial and social aspects of development industries and the task of training specialists.

 

In the course of the discussions, promising areas for further research were considered and possible ways of solving the most significant problems were formulated.

 

A collection of conferences published 181 reports. In particular, in the Technique and Technology section for processing agricultural raw materials and food production, their quality and safety published -109 reports, in the Technology and Safety section of goods and products of light and textile industry; design and fashion – 21 reports, in the section Economic issues of food, light industry and hospitality industry, technology of restaurant and hotel business – 51 reports.

The competition of projects “START-UP ATU-2019” is held from November 12 to April 26, 2019 and is held in three stages.

 

The first stage (intra-faculty) is the development of a start-up concept for the project, the design and submission of applications for participation in the START-UP ATU-2019 Project Competition (from November 11 to February 18, 2019). The first stage is conducted in departments and laboratories. The best projects are reviewed and approved at a meeting of the NMS faculties until 02.22.2019.

 

The second stage (intra-university) – presentation and selection of promising start-up projects, will be held February 26, 2019 with the participation of members of the NTS and mentors.

 

Third stage (final) – presentation of start-up projects on April 19, 2019 before the Expert Council of the START-UP ATU-2019 Project Contest, determining the winners who achieved the best results in work on start-up projects after the second stage

 

April 26, 2019 in the framework of the Republican Scientific and Practical Conference of Young Scientists “Science. Education. Youth ”, the awarding ceremony of the START-UP ATU-2019 Project Contest Winners will be held. Winners of the START-UP ATU-2018 Project Competition will receive grants for the implementation of a start-up project to create a small innovative enterprise from business partners and other investors.

 

To participate in the competition of projects are invited students, undergraduates, doctoral students, young scientists and faculty of the university without age limit, having innovative business ideas. The contestants have a task to create an original, high-tech and commercially promising start-up project. Contestants have the opportunity to find a potential investor or business partner.

 

WHAT IS STARTUP / START UP?

Start up is a newly created company (perhaps even not being a legal entity), which is at the stage of development and is building its business either on the basis of new innovative ideas or on the basis of newly emerging technologies.

 

The main resource for creating a new startup is a good innovative idea. The main objectives of the project competition “START – UP ATU-2019” are:
